General Manager and Partner

2001 – 2022
Theatre Bizarre · Detroit, MI · (Stage Manager, 2001–2010)
  • Brought in as a full partner to professionalize the organization during its move to the Detroit Masonic Temple, turning a money-losing backyard event into a financially sustainable, internationally recognized immersive production drawing 5,000 guests a night.
  • Built and ran a 50-plus department leadership and budgeting structure across 21 performance spaces and 8 stages, directing 9 department heads, 50+ managers, and nearly 1,000 performers, crew, and volunteers.
  • Owned a seven-figure annual budget, vendor contracts, payroll, and venue agreements; managed a 75-person security team alongside onsite EMTs, coordinating with the fire marshal, Detroit Police, and city officials on all safety and compliance.
  • Expanded the organization into year-round programming including festival installations, ticketed pop-ups, parade builds, and public activations.

Co-Founder and Creative Director

Aug 2019 – Present
The Adventureman's Guild · Detroit Metro Area
  • Co-founded and lead a national membership organization (110+ members, 4 chapters), planning and coordinating logistics for 70+ events across Michigan and beyond, including international expeditions in Costa Rica, Japan, and Vietnam.
  • Created the Great American Monkey 1000, a 1,000 km motorcycle adventure for 50 riders navigated entirely through a hand-fabricated narrative mail art system of physical letters, telegrams, and ephemera from a fictional explorer.
  • Wrote and produced the Guild's printed field handbook, designed the complete brand system (patches, uniform, merchandise, collateral), and built the merit badge, rank, and mentorship structure alongside the chapter leadership model.
